Its built-in 4G LTE and GPS capabilities let you keep an eye on where your kids are at all times, while the tracker's wide range of capabilities help them stay active and keep an eye on how much they've accomplished, including built-in games that encourage them to get moving — if nothing else can get them off of Roblox, a fun new piece of tech might.
The watch has a 16-hour battery life as well as fast charging to get it back up to 11 hours of runtime in just 30 minutes, as well as parental options like School Time, which you can turn on so little ones can't start gaming on their watch while they're supposed to be studying. And if they ever need to pay with their watch, Tap to Pay makes a great addition to its feature set.
